  • Patent number: 10874222
    Abstract: A ready-to-assemble (“RTA”) sofa suitable for outdoor use comprising a seat base and a back rest that can be reconfigured between a use configuration in which the sofa has a conventional L-shaped cross-section and a shipping or storage configuration in which the sofa is arranged in a more efficiently stacked rectangular cross-section. The rectangular cross-section allows the sofa to be more efficiently stacked with other sofas during shipping or storage. In addition, the rectangular cross-section reduces the dead spaces created when an L-shaped sofa is inserted into a box that can collapse during shipping or storage. Moreover, providing a single rigid integral component, the seat base, as an internal skeletal component, provides vertical support extending substantially the height of the box at the opposing ends, provides a highly robust boxed package.

  • Patent number: 10154732
    Abstract: A portable surface for lounging or sleeping with an elevated leg rest and backrest, and a seat that rests on the ground or other supporting surface such as a car seat, truck bed or bleacher. The various parts of the chair can be folded up and nest inside of each other in a compact bundle that may fit in a backpack or a map pocket for easy portability. When folded up, a strap can be tightened around the apparatus preventing the innards from unfolding, creating a smaller profile.

  • Patent number: 6499804
    Abstract: An easy chair device has a leg frame, and a chair main body disposed on the leg frame. Two backrest support rods and two armrest support rods extend upward from the leg frame. The chair main body has a backrest, a seat, and two armrests. The armrests are supported by the armrest support rods and the backrest support rods. A back band is disposed on a back of the backrest. Two fasteners are disposed on two ends of the back band. Two fastening bands are disposed on the armrests to engage with the back band.
